> As described by [~Paul.Rogers]
> "
> We have multiple ways of reporting errors:
> * Throw a UserException explaining the error
> * Throw an unchecked exception and and let the fragment executor guess the cause.
> * Return STOP
> * Tell the fragment executor to fail. (A we also required to return STOP?)
> * Return OUT_OF_MEMORY status
> The proposal is to replace them all with a single solution: throw a UserException. Each operator catches other exceptions and translates them to UserException.
> Java unwinds the stack just fine; no reason for us to write code to do it via STOP.
> Then, the Fragment Executor calls close() on all operators. No reason to try to do this cleanup on STOP. (Even if we do, the lower-level operators won't have seen the STOP.)
> Since failures are hard to test, and have cause no end of problems, having multiple ways to do the same thing is really not that helpful to Drill users.
